Using Basic Phone Functions Understanding Your Phone's Lines and Buttons 3 Table 1 IP Phone Components # Phone Feature 10 Setup button 11 Mute button 12 Volume button 13 Headset button 14 Speaker button Description Press to access the phone's configuration menu to configure features and preferences (such as your directory and speed dials), access your call history, and set up functions (such as call forwarding). Push to mute or unmute the phone. When phone is muted, the button lights red. Press + to increase the volume and - to lower the volume of the handset, headset, speaker (when the handset is off hook), or ringer volume (when the handset is on hook). Push to turn the headset on or off. When the headset is on, the button lights green. Push to turn the speaker on or off. When the speaker is on, the button lights green. Softkey Buttons The softkey buttons perform the actions shown on the label on the LCD screen above. The softkey buttons available on your phone may vary depending on your phone system. For the SPA9XX phones, use the right navigation button to scroll and view additional softkey buttons. Softkey buttons that may be available are described below.
